Repetitive occurrence of explosive events at a coronal hole boundary
Doyle, J. G.; Popescu, M. D.; Taroyan, Y.
SUMER/SoHO data taken at a coronal hole boundary show a repetitive explosive event occurrence rate of around 3 min increasing to over 5 min towards the end of the activity. Ionospheric plasma acceleration at Mars: ASPERA-3 results
Coates, A. J.; Kallio, E.; Fedorov, A. +42 more
The Analyzer of Space Plasma and Energetic Atoms (ASPERA) on-board the Mars Express spacecraft (MEX) measured penetrating solar wind plasma and escaping/accelerated ionospheric plasma at very low altitudes (250 km) in the dayside subsolar region. The size and albedo of Rosetta fly-by target 21 Lutetia from new IRTF measurements and thermal modeling
Hora, J. L.; Mueller, M.; Adams, J. D. +3 more
Recent spectroscopic observations indicate that the M-type asteroid 21 Lutetia has a primitive, carbonaceous-chondrite-like (C-type) surface composition for which a low geometric albedo would be expected; this is incompatible with the IRAS albedo of 0.221± 0.020.
